Hi Everyone,

 

I was just wondering if the setup machine is no longer compatible with Animation Master as it seems to crash whenever I try using it with A:M 17.

 

I haven't encountered any issue with it when I was using an old version like 11 but I can't even get the rigger to load without it crashing anymore...

 

Maybe there's something I have to do to make it compatible in 17?

 

I don't mind boning everything by hand, but this was a neat tool before when I tried using it to rig a model quickly...

 

Thank you everyone

It should work with the 32bit version...I don't think it works in the 64bit version. You can have both installed at the same time.

 

Hope that helps.

Yes you can have both 64 and 32bit Windows versions installed at the same time. I believe all you need do is to just copy the licence file (master0.lic) from your 64bit version into the 32bit version.

With every release Jason links to the 32bit and 64bit installers.

Install both and run them simultaneously if you wish.

 

There are several things that will not work in 64bit... such as rendering to Quicktime/.MOV format.

For such things simply launch A:M in 32bit.

 

As has been suggested copy your Master.lic license file from your the one installation directory to the other.
